Pegex::Bootstrap - Bootstrapping Compiler for a Pegex Grammar
use Pegex::Bootstrap; my $grammar_text = '... grammar text ...'; my $pegex_compiler = Pegex::Bootstrap->new(); my $grammar_tree = $pegex_compiler->compile($grammar_text)->tree;
The Pegex language is defined in Pegex. In order to do that, it was necessary to make a bootstrap compiler that did the same thing. This way we could slowly build up the grammar, and make sure that the 2 compilers do the same thing. Parsing the Pegex language itself is not terribly hard, so this module just does it by hand.
Unless you are working on Pegex itself, you can ignore this module.
